RECEIVED <br />UUnified JUL 2 8 2014 <br />jYGG'vY'S. �ehVt'e <br />Distribution Q��& HEA <br />ANY SPILL OR RELEASE OF HAZARDOUS MATERIALS <br />The State of California has no RQ for reporting spills or releases. Any release regardless of <br />size must be reported.
